Country star Brooke Moriber is more than just a country star. With ‘Half a Heart’, her latest release, Moriber gives us a heart-rending ballad of epic proportions that is one-hundred percent ready for mainstream radio attention, with rich lyrics, virtuosic vocals, and masterful production.
Brooke Moriber operates from New York. She is a singer and songwriter who is challenging her country background with her latest release and succeeding in the task with flying colors. First things first, Moriber’s voice is spectacular here. Spectral and deeply stirring, she is constantly toying with the listeners, shifting her hearty belts into the gentlest croons in the matter of a single syllable. Soulful to say the least, Brooke Moriber is a fantastic singer, and ‘Half a Heart’ is an adequate representation of her talent.
The music is no slouch either. A lush arrangement that continues to grow throughout the song’s 3 and a half minutes runtime, with pauses, a scorching crescendo, and a colorful, bluesy guitar solo, ‘Half a Heart’ is guaranteed to wow the audiences with the effectiveness of its melodies, swells, and atmospheres, and being of this grand scale, I can easily see those audiences being stadium-sized.
